13301323332013 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 13696345579896. Its totient is φ = 12909662976000.
The previous prime is 13301323331999. The next prime is 13301323332053. The reversal of 13301323332013 is 31023332310331.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in 4 ways, for example, as 76041923049 + 13225281408964 = 275757^2 + 3636658^2 .
It is a sphenic number, since it is the product of 3 distinct primes.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 13301323332013 - 217 = 13301323200941 is a prime.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(13301323332053)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 840464938 + ... + 840480763.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(1712043197487).
Almost surely, 213301323332013 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
13301323332013 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(395022247883).
13301323332013 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
13301323332013 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 1680945935.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 8748, while the sum is 28.
Adding to 13301323332013 its reverse (31023332310331), we get a palindrome (44324655642344).
The spelling of 13301323332013 in words is "thirteen trillion, three hundred one billion, three hundred twenty-three million, three hundred thirty-two thousand, thirteen".
